Indulge in the rich, moist goodness of Dairy-Free Banana Bread with Chocolate Chips, a wholesome twist on a classic comfort food favorite. This recipe delivers a velvety texture and natural sweetness by combining ripe bananas, coconut oil, and a homemade flax egg, making it completely dairy-free and perfect for vegan diets. A splash of almond milk mixed with apple cider vinegar creates a creamy, tangy buttermilk substitute, ensuring a tender crumb every time. Studded with dairy-free chocolate chips, each slice offers irresistible bursts of melty chocolate.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9x5 inch loaf pan with coconut oil or line it with parchment paper.
In a small bowl, combine the flaxseed meal and water to create a flax egg. Stir well and let it sit for about 5 minutes to thicken.
In a large mixing bowl, mash the ripe bananas using a fork or a potato masher until smooth.
Add the coconut oil, brown sugar, and vanilla extract to the mashed bananas. Mix well until everything is thoroughly combined.
Stir in the prepared flax egg.
In another b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, baking soda, and salt.
Add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ing gently until just combined. Do not overmix.
In a small bowl, combine the almond milk and apple cider vinegar to make a dairy-free buttermilk substitute.
Pour the almond milk mixture into the batter, stirring until the batter is smooth.
Fold in the dairy-free chocolate chips until they are evenly distributed throughout the batter.
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and spread it evenly.
Bake in the preheated oven for 50-55 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
Allow the banana bread to cool in the pan for about 10 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ely before slicing.
